Abstract
The disclosed tactile interface device conveys a diversity of information to its operator through the operator'"'"'s tactile sense without requiring the operators visual confirmation. The tactile interface device comprises a substructure on which magnets are arranged so that the positive and negative magnets are alternately placed, a frame that is movable on the substructure and on which coils are installed, and a pushbutton switch fixed to the frame. The operating element drive control means drives the switch in the two-dimensional direction by allowing current to flow through the coils in a predetermined direction, so that a motion pattern appropriate for the information to be conveyed to the operator is generated. Information is imparted to the operator from the switch through the operator'"'"'s tactile sense.

9. A tactile interface device comprising
a substructure member; -
a touch element to be touched by the operator of said tactile interface device;
a movable member which is mounted on and is movable relative to said substructure member and to which said touch element is fixed; and
a touch element drive control means for driving said touch element in one or two dimensions by moving said movable member;
wherein said touch element drive control means drives said movable member to move in a predetermined motion pattern corresponding to manipulation of said touch element by an operator. - View Dependent Claims (10, 11, 12)
